技术博客

跨平台WebView组件的开发与应用

本文将介绍一个支持Android和iOS平台的WebView组件,该组件不仅具有高度自适应性,还能实现在HTML页面与React Native组件间互相调用JavaScript方法的功能。通过详细的代码示例,读者可以更好地理解和应用这些技术,提高开发效率。

WebView组件跨平台支持JavaScript调用HTML页面React Native
2024-09-29
React Native云翻译客户端:程序员专属开源工具的诞生

“Programmer”是一款专为程序员设计的云翻译客户端,此项目完全基于React Native框架开发,旨在提供一个高效的编程辅助工具。作为一个开源项目,“Programmer”邀请全球的技术爱好者共同参与开发,通过贡献代码和建议来不断完善这款应用。为了增加文章的实用性与可读性,文中提供了丰富的代码示例,展示了如何利用React Native构建跨平台的移动应用。

React Native云翻译程序员工具开源项目代码示例
2024-09-29
深入解析React Native下拉刷新与滑动回弹组件:PullView与PullList

本文将详细介绍React Native中的两个实用组件——PullView和PullList,它们能够轻松实现下拉刷新及滑动回弹功能,适用于Android与iOS两大平台。通过本文提供的代码示例,读者可以快速掌握如何在自己的项目中集成这些功能,提升应用程序的用户体验。

React NativePullViewPullList下拉刷新滑动回弹
2024-09-29
深入解析React Native下拉刷新组件:功能与实战

本文将深入探讨一款专为React Native设计的下拉刷新组件,该组件兼容Android与iOS两大平台,基于纯JavaScript开发,构建于ScrollView之上。通过增加三种下拉刷新状态,此组件极大提升了用户交互体验,同时保持了ScrollView原有的全部特性。文中提供了详尽的代码示例,助力开发者快速掌握并灵活运用这一实用工具。

下拉刷新React NativeJavaScriptScrollView代码示例
2024-09-29
深入探索Reactotron:提升React应用监控与调试效率

Reactotron作为一款功能强大的开发工具,为React DOM及React Native应用程序的控制、监控与检查提供了便捷的途径。尤其对于React Native版本0.23及以上以及React DOM版本15及以上的项目来说,Reactotron不仅简化了开发流程,还极大地提高了调试效率。本文将通过丰富的代码示例,详细阐述如何利用Reactotron优化开发体验。

ReactotronReact DOMReact Native代码示例应用监控
2024-09-29
React Native应用调试利器:AsyncStorage的用户界面构建解析

在开发React Native应用的过程中,调试AsyncStorage往往让开发者感到棘手,尤其是在真机调试时,验证存储数据的有效性变得尤为困难。鉴于此,本文介绍了一种通过构建用户界面来简化调试过程的方法,旨在帮助开发者更高效地解决AsyncStorage相关的挑战。文中提供了丰富的代码示例,以便于读者理解和实践。

React NativeAsyncStorage真机调试用户界面代码示例
2024-09-29
基于F8框架的React Native应用开发:漫威风格实现详解

本文将带领读者深入了解一款基于F8开发框架,采用漫威风格设计的React Native应用程序。这款应用不仅展示了跨平台开发的魅力,还特别强调了其在Android和iOS两大操作系统上的兼容性。通过访问http://developer.marvel.com/ 注册并获取API密钥,开发者可以轻松地将这一创新应用部署到自己的设备上,体验其独特的功能与设计。

F8框架漫威风格React NativeAndroid兼容iOS兼容
2024-09-29
React Native入门指南:iOS示例和学习清单

本文旨在为读者提供一系列React Native的示例,特别关注其在iOS平台上的应用。通过详细的步骤指导以及丰富的代码示例,帮助开发者从零开始掌握React Native的安装与基本使用方法。无论你是初学者还是有一定经验的开发者,都能从中找到有用的信息,加速开发流程。

React NativeiOS示例学习清单npm安装代码示例
2024-09-29
React Native Mapping Integration:跨平台地图集成解决方案

本文旨在介绍一个名为“React Native Mapping Integration”的包,该包为开发者提供了在iOS和Android平台上无缝集成地图的功能。通过详细的代码示例,本文将帮助读者快速掌握如何利用这一工具来增强其应用程序的地图功能。

React Native地图集成代码示例iOS平台Android平台
2024-09-29
探索MacOS平台下的React Native IDE:打造iOS开发的利器

本文将向读者介绍一款专为React Native开发者设计的MacOS X平台上的集成开发环境(IDE)。这款IDE不仅简化了iOS应用开发流程,还特别集成了实时预览功能,让开发者可以即时看到代码更改后的效果,极大地提升了开发效率。通过本文,读者将了解到如何利用这款IDE来加速React Native项目的开发,并通过丰富的代码示例掌握其使用方法。

MacOS IDEReact Native实时预览iOS开发代码示例
2024-09-29
融合React Native和React Router的页面导航解决方案

本文旨在探讨如何巧妙地融合React Native与React Router两大技术组件,以实现更加灵活高效的应用程序开发。通过深入分析React Native提供的Navigator组件,本文将展示其如何管理页面堆栈及导航,同时介绍其对生命周期管理的支持以及页面跳转动画的实现方式。为了增强读者的理解与实际应用能力,文中将提供具体的代码示例。

React NativeReact RouterNavigator组件页面堆栈代码示例
2024-09-29
KanZhiHuRN移动应用开发指南

KanZhiHuRN 是一款利用 React Native 0.24.0 和 Redux 框架打造的跨平台移动应用程序,支持 iOS 与 Android 双平台运行。此应用不仅提供了流畅的用户体验,还具备了拖动刷新及上拉自动加载更多内容的功能,极大地提升了用户的互动性和信息获取效率。文章深入探讨了其技术实现细节,并通过丰富的代码示例帮助开发者理解和掌握相关技术。

KanZhiHuRNReact NativeRedux框架拖动刷新代码示例
2024-09-28
使用React Native和Redux开发Reddit应用

本文旨在介绍如何使用React Native和Redux技术来开发Reddit应用。它不仅为初学者提供了学习React Native和Redux的绝佳入门示例,还深入探讨了项目搭建、组件设计以及状态管理等关键领域,并提供了丰富的代码示例,帮助读者更好地理解和掌握这些技术。通过本文的学习,读者可以快速上手React Native和Redux,为未来的移动应用开发奠定坚实基础。

React NativeReduxReddit应用状态管理组件设计
2024-09-28
使用 React Native 框架构建 OS X 桌面应用程序

React Native Desktop 技术为开发者提供了利用熟悉的 React Native 框架来构建适用于 OS X 的桌面应用的可能性。本文将通过具体的代码示例,如使用 View 和 Button 组件,展示如何实现基本的应用交互,特别是通过 onClick 事件处理用户点击操作。

React NativeOS XView 组件Button 组件onClick 事件
2024-09-28
深入浅出:使用React Native和Node.js开发HackerWeb iOS应用

本文将介绍如何利用React Native与Node.js 4.0技术构建一款名为HackerWeb的iOS应用,该应用旨在为用户提供一个简洁且高效的Hacker News阅读体验。通过详细步骤与代码示例,本文旨在帮助开发者理解并掌握相关开发技巧,尤其是在Xcode 7环境下进行iOS 9应用程序的设计与实现。

HackerWebiOS应用React NativeNode.jsXcode 7
2024-09-27
基于React Native框架的下拉刷新和上拉加载控件

本文旨在介绍一款基于React Native框架并使用纯JavaScript开发的下拉刷新及上拉加载更多功能的控件。此控件不仅简化了开发流程,还确保了应用在Android和iOS两大平台上的良好表现。通过详细的操作指南与丰富的代码示例,本文将帮助开发者快速掌握该控件的使用方法,提高应用程序的用户体验。

React NativeJavaScript下拉刷新上拉加载跨平台
2024-09-27